About Rondebosch Time Zone
Rondebosch, South Africa uses Africa/Johannesburg, the standard time zone for South Africa. The UTC offset is UTC+2 all year, and Rondebosch does not observe daylight saving time, so the clock stays stable through every month of the year.
That makes Rondebosch, South Africa straightforward for recurring scheduling because there are no seasonal clock changes to remember locally. It also aligns with the broader South African business day, which is useful for schools, local services, and companies working across Cape Town and Johannesburg, while still requiring careful coordination with places like London and New York that do change seasonally.
Because Rondebosch, South Africa sits on the same national time as the rest of South Africa, it behaves predictably for domestic travel and business. It is also a practical reference point for regional coordination with nearby African markets, while remaining distinctly different from Europe, the US East Coast, and Asia-Pacific time zones that shift more dramatically across the year.
Rondebosch City Details
Rondebosch, South Africa has a population of 15,158, making it a compact urban area within the Cape Town metro. Its coordinates are -33.96333°, 18.47639°, which places it in the southern part of South Africa’s Western Cape near major academic, residential, and transport corridors.
The currency used in Rondebosch, South Africa is the South African Rand (ZAR), and the country dialing code is +27. Time Differences from Rondebosch
Rondebosch, South Africa is 7 hours ahead of New York in January: when it is 9:00 AM in Rondebosch, it is 2:00 AM in New York. In July, Rondebosch is 6 hours ahead of New York: when it is 9:00 AM in Rondebosch, it is 3:00 AM in New York. That seasonal shift matters for US-East Coast meetings, especially when a Cape Town team is trying to reach finance, media, or tech contacts in New York.
Rondebosch, South Africa is 2 hours ahead of London in January: when it is 9:00 AM in Rondebosch, it is 7:00 AM in London. In July, Rondebosch is 1 hour ahead of London: when it is 9:00 AM in Rondebosch, it is 8:00 AM in London. This is often useful for consulting firms, legal teams, and travel planners who work between South Africa and the UK.
Rondebosch, South Africa is 7 hours behind Tokyo in January: when it is 9:00 AM in Rondebosch, it is 4:00 PM in Tokyo. In July, Rondebosch is still 7 hours behind Tokyo: when it is 9:00 AM in Rondebosch, it is 4:00 PM in Tokyo. That stable gap helps with software development handoffs and manufacturing coordination with Japanese partners.
Rondebosch, South Africa is 9 hours behind Sydney in January: when it is 9:00 AM in Rondebosch, it is 6:00 PM in Sydney. In July, Rondebosch is 8 hours behind Sydney: when it is 9:00 AM in Rondebosch, it is 5:00 PM in Sydney. This difference is important for teams handling tourism, education, or logistics between South Africa and Australia.
Rondebosch, South Africa is 2 hours behind Dubai in January: when it is 9:00 AM in Rondebosch, it is 11:00 AM in Dubai. In July, Rondebosch is also 2 hours behind Dubai: when it is 9:00 AM in Rondebosch, it is 11:00 AM in Dubai. That steady relationship is helpful for trade, aviation, and procurement teams working across the Gulf and South Africa.
